Full Vande Mataram rendition not mandatory, only guidelines exist: Kerala CM VD Satheesan amid row with Governor

Arlekar was displeased that neither was the song sung in full, it was only played by a band.

Satheesan said that the Congress and its UDF alliance work within the framework of a political ideology and is governed according to the decisions of the party's central leadership.

He said that the party's central leadership has a clear stand on the issue and that is applicable to the alliance also.

The CM also said that singing the Vande Mataram in full was not mandatory as there was no law enacted in that regard by the Parliament. "There are only some guidelines issued by the Parliament," he said. - EndsPublished By: Shipra ParasharPublished On: May 29, 2026 23:46 IST
